Building Bridges
Weekly Program
Brother Marvin "Doc" Cheatham, President, Baltimore NAACP;Charles Lloyd, Jr. composer, tenor; Robert Mack as Emmett; soprano Diana Solomon-Glover as Mamie; bass Kevin Maynor as the funeral director
 Ken Nash and Mimi Rosenberg  Contact Contributor
Aug. 29, 2009, 3:22 p.m.
Emmett Till the opera commemorating the horrific beating and murder of the boy child, Emmett Till in Money Miss. August 28 1955. Plus NAACP Passes Resolution for Mumia and other prisoners on death row.
Produced by Mimi Rosenberg and Ken Nash
